On January 15, Zombies enthusiasts will have a lot to look forward to as Treyarch Studios, the developer behind Call of Duty: Black Ops 6, has announced plans to unveil details about the next map for the Zombies mode. Currently, fans can enjoy three distinct Zombies maps, but with the extended development cycle of four years for the latest installment, Treyarch seems poised to deliver a wealth of Zombies content. The fourth map is set to debut with the launch of Season 2.
As Season 2 of Call of Duty: Black Ops 6 approaches, excitement is building among fans across all game modes—Multiplayer, Zombies, and Warzone. Season 1 has been notably long, leaving players eagerly anticipating the new content that Treyarch Studios has in store for Black Ops 6 in the upcoming season. While many expected a delay in announcements, Zombies fans won't have to wait much longer for fresh content.
In an exciting update shared on Twitter, Treyarch Studios announced that they have "plenty to share with the Zombies community" on January 15, including specifics about the next Zombies map. While the full details will be revealed on Wednesday, industry insider TheGhostOfHope has leaked that the new round-based Zombies map will launch with Season 2 on January 28. Contrary to expectations that the map would be released in a mid-Season 2 update, it appears it will be available at the season's start.
There's a lot at stake for Call of Duty: Black Ops 6's Season 2, but fans of Multiplayer and Warzone will need to wait a bit longer for news on their updates. Multiplayer fans can anticipate a range of new maps, weapons, events, and more. Meanwhile, Warzone players are particularly vocal about the need for the developers to tackle the ongoing hacking issues, which have contributed to a decline in player numbers.
Recent updates to Warzone have only exacerbated player frustrations, introducing new glitches in the Ranked Play mode, such as players exploiting the map and issues with Buy Stations. These new problems have emerged even as other bugs and glitches remain unaddressed. While Season 2 promises a host of new content, Warzone players are primarily hoping for extensive bug fixes to improve their gaming experience.
